Ascot Lloyd is a leading independent financial advice and wealth management firm based in the UK. Founded in 2004, the company has seen rapid growth through both organic expansion and the acquisition of smaller Independent Financial Adviser (IFA) firms. The firm provides a comprehensive suite of services including financial planning, wealth management, retirement and pension advice, protection planning, and corporate benefit solutions.

Ascot Lloyd recently set aside £76 million in order to cover potential redress for clients of their wealth management division who have been paying annual management fees but may not have received annual reviews from the Financial Adviser.

There are currently two active firms on the FCA register relating to Ascot Lloyd, Ascot Lloyd Ltd and Ascot Lloyd Investment Management Ltd. (ALIM)

For the purposes of helping clients seeking financial redress from Ascot Lloyd this page will be dedicated to ALIM as this is the firm which holds regulated permissions for Promoting, Arranging & Managing Pensions and Investments.

Why can you claim for compensation or redress against Ascot Lloyd

If you have been a financial advice client of Ascot Lloyd Investment Management Limited you may be eligible for financial redress if you were advised to transfer from existing pension or investments schemes to a new platform, or if you have not received annual reviews from your financial adviser.

 

Background

Companies House show the Company was incorporated on 31/08/2012 under company reference number 08197347.

According to the FCA Register the company has been authorised since 01/06/16 and has applied to cancel since 09/02/2015

This company is associated with claims for lack of ongoing servicing (Financial Adviser Fees).
